Heads up, plugin folks: if GraphScribe's CI chokes on your manifest, it's usually the edge-renderer cache going stale between runs. Clear your workspace, re-pin the layout toolkit, and retry before filing anything. If it still fails, grab the token from the last green run and paste it below.

build token for kagaf-hahof: htk14_9d3d4d26d7d8de

Handover — Petra to Callum

Callum, passing you the big-deal discount file. Sales leads: current rule stands — anything over the Tier 3 threshold needs director sign-off, and we cap discounts at 18% unless multi-year. I've been flexible on the Norbeck accounts; use your judgement there. Don't let reps anchor on last year's exceptions. Full approvals log is in the deals tracker. One more thing before you dive in — read the note below.

internal memo for kawip-hadug: Headcount on the Wenwyn team goes from 7 to 140 by the end of January. Gross margin on Wenwyn came in at 20 percent against a plan of 15 percent.

Bounce processor (Mailsift) — recovery

If the bounce queue backs up past 50k, restart the consumer pool first; don't clear the queue. Hard bounces are idempotent, soft bounces retry with backoff, so reprocessing is safe. Check the suppression-list writer last — it lags by design. After restart, verify the worker picks up the expected settings, which should match the block below.

settings of fafog-haduf:
ZORIX_PIN=4648
ZORIX_METRICS_HOST=metrics.zorix.paliqsys.corp
ZORIX_LOG_LEVEL=info
ZORIX_TENANT=druix

**Ticket: Dedup service credential expired**

The Hushline alert deduplicator stopped suppressing duplicates at 02:40 because its credential for the internal alert bus lapsed; pages tripled overnight. Root cause: the rotation job covers ingestion workers but skips the dedup sidecar, a gap introduced during the container split last quarter. Future maintainers: add the sidecar to the rotation manifest so this cannot recur silently. Until then, the dedup sidecar should authenticate with the replacement key below.

API key for tagug-tajef: vxb4-R1fo